#27128 - 1970s Van Cleef & Arpels Mod Gold Bangle Bracelet
Price: $14,500.00

Circa 1970s, 18k, Van Cleef & Arpels, France. Art informs fashion in this chic Mod sixties bangle by Van Cleef and Arpels. The mix of white and yellow gold creates exciting movement of light, and the use of hand-fabrication in creating a true basket weave gives it visual authority. The look is an evocative mix of glamour and visionary French style.

Remarks from Lawrence Jeffrey: “There is an authenticity to jewelry with hand-worked detail; nothing else looks the same. It gives a piece that undefinable something extra…… Basket weave gold is an iconic VCA motif”
Condition: Excellent condition.
Weight: 37.7 g
Stones: None
Hallmarks: VCA, B2262I6, French eagle head for 18k, OR, and 750 for 18k
Measurements: 2 1/2 inch diameter, fits average wrist.
